"Click-Clack Waddle Dot Dewey Dew from Planet Eight Hundred Seventy-Two Point Nine does not want to go to school--not on his planet, and definitely not on Planet Earth at Mrs. Brightsun's School for Little Learners. Everything on Earth is different. His clothes don't fit right, his classmates don't look like him, and even Earth noises sound weird. In this first day of school story with a twist, nervous Dewey Dew learns that new experiences--like going to school on another planet--might be okay after all"--… (altro)

Dewey, an alien, is about to start school for the first time. Not just any school, school on EARTH! When he begins, he is nervous and confused because everything around him is so different and confusing, even the students! However, he ends up making a friend and realizes that maybe it is not so bad after all! This is a perfect book to read to students in the beginning of the school year, because although no one is an alien, everyone can relate to the nervousness of the first day! It shows the silly and also serious side of Dewey and really depicts what the first day of school feels like from the inside! The only thing I did not particularly like about the book is that sometimes it was written in "alien" language, which was a good idea but can also be confusing to younger kids who are just learning how to comprehend what they are reading! Summary: This book is about a little alien named Dewy who goes to earth school for the first time. He is really scared and thinks that everything is so different on earth. He is very overwhelmed by all the changes and how different he is from everyone else. J.J. Havermeir the Third, a boy in the class, asks him to stand in line with him, and this made him happy. Dewey ended up having a great day at school.
Genre: This book is fantasy because the events in the story cannot actually happen. The author makes the reader think that aliens can really go to school with humans on earth. She does this by making the story consistent and by creating a different language that the aliens use. It is not super different then english and isn't used the whole time, so the book is still easy to read.
Medium: colored pencil
Age Appropriateness: primary
Use in a classroom: This book could be used to help students understand what it may be like if there were a new student in their classroom. It gives them the perspective of Dewy who is different then the rest of his class, and this could show students what it may feel like for someone who is from a different culture or area. You could have them share about different traditions or ways of life they have at home to show them that they are all different and have different ways of doing things. One could use J.J. Havermeir the Third as an example of what to do when there is someone who feels different and is different then you, include them!

Genre: Science Fiction
Age: Primary
Review: This story was about Dewey Dew, an alien who had to go to school on earth. He was afraid because he didn't fit in with the other students and everything was different to him. At the end, a little boy came over and they began to play. Dewey Dew decided that school on earth probably wouldn't be so bad after all. This is science fiction because it was about an alien from another planet coming to earth.
Comment on use: This could be used in the classroom to explain how some students may feel coming to a new school. It could also be used to discuss how we should include everyone, even if they are different from us.
Media: Pencil, watercolor and digital media ( )
